Description

Helicobacter pylori strain ZH82 is a Gram-negative, microaerophilic bacterium characterized by its spirilla shape and single-cell arrangement. This strain thrives optimally at a temperature of 37.0°C, which corresponds to the typical human body temperature, indicating its adaptation to a host-associated habitat. H. pylori is well-known for its colonization of the gastric epithelium, where it can survive in the acidic environment of the stomach, a trait that may be linked to its microaerophilic nature, allowing it to thrive in low-oxygen conditions.
